Three types of rice flour, Q, R and S come in containers of 120 g, 150 g and 240 g respectively. Containers of Q, R and S are mixed together in the ratio 3 : 5 : 6 to obtain 15.3 kg of an assortment of rice flour.
- How many containers of Q and R are used altogether?
- Find the difference between the combined weight of all the rice flour in containers R and containers S as compared to the rice flour in containers Q. Express the weight in kilograms.
|
Q |
R |
S |
Number |
3 u |
5 u |
6 u |
Value |
120 |
150 |
240 |
Total value |
360 u |
750 u |
1440 u |
(a)
Total mass of rice flour
= 360 u + 750 u + 1440 u
= 2550 u
2550 u = 15300
1 u = 15300 ÷ 2550 = 6
Total number of containers of Q and R used
= 3 u + 5 u
= 8 u
= 8 x 6
= 48
(b)
Combined weight of all the rice flour in containers R and containers S
= 750 u + 1440 u
= 2190 u
Difference between the combined weight of all the rice flour in containers R and containers S as compared to the rice flour in containers Q
= 2190 u - 360 u
= 1830 u
= 1830 x 6
= 10980 g
= 10.98 kg
Answer(s): (a) 48; (b) 10.98 kg
